  • Have to say, it’s super exciting to get HS kids again, not JuCo scout team guys from military bases or bottom tier programs nobody has heard of. 22 commits as of now, all high schoolers.

    I also expect that to be about it on commits. We’ll have some churn before all the dust settles because football recruiting is insane but 23 is about all we can do. And some of those will get pulled from 2021. I looked up the roster numbers the other day: 47 (!) upperclassmen, only 22 underclassmen. We’re 16 short of 85 with half the number of underclassmen as most well-run programs. The damage Beaty and Weis did to the roster is near catastrophic. If we hit on every kid, it’ll still be 2023 before we approach the 85 number.

  • Also remember that these are “commits”…with a small “c”. With the churn in commits that seems to occur in any program, especially ones like ours in at best "rebuilding mode (remember we have already had one “100% committed” de-commit) you need to have some “overage” in “commits” (still a small “c”) just because when signing day rolls around you don’t want any spaces to go unfilled and you know some “commits” (again with a small “c”) won’t COMMIT (with a capital “C”) when signing on the line time comes. It’s still some time between now and national signing day.



  • Miles may also get creative with the roster this year to help manage how many people roll out of the program. I could see possibly grabbing a few more preferred walk ons, as well as potentially redshirting upperclassmen to help balance the classes a little bit more.

    And he still has the option of moving recruits into the 2020 or 2021 class (possible January 2021 reports for some) to help balance a bit more.
